-
队伍名称:铁锅炖大鹅队伍编号:CICC1891根据加速器所需完成的功能,我们自定义了5条指令,分别是加速器参数读取指令nice_param、权重读取指令conv_weight、特征图读取指令conv_...
-
3.添加ip_reset_sysnuclei-kit的RTL顶层还使用了 Processor System Reset IP核,所以要把这个IP核添加进去。在IP Catalog中搜索reset,如下...
-
团队编号:CICC3196团队名词:UNICRON事情是这样的,前段时间试图用DDR3代替ITCM和DTCM,功能上是没问题,但代码运行速度实在是惨不忍睹,而DTCM实在是不够用,所以又把主意打到了I...
-
1.SD卡引脚接口SD卡可分为三类:标准 SD 卡、MiniSD 卡和 MicroSD 卡。DDR200T提供了两个标准SD卡槽,分别连接FPGA以及MCU。我们采用SPI协议从SD卡中读取bmp格式...
-
所用开发板:主控芯片型号:1.将E203开源项目整个过程文件进行下载。下载地址:https://github.com/riscv-mcu/e203_hbirdv2(github越来越不好用了,国内经常...
-
NICE协处理器的接口信号如表4-1所示。表4-1 NICE协处理器的接口信号 通道 方向 宽度 信号名 说明请求通道 Output 1 nice_req_valid 主处理器向协处理器发送指令请求信...
-
支持协处理器访问存储器资源可以扩大协处理器的类型范围,使协处理器不仅限于执行运算指令类型。在处理器的LSU模块中为NICE协处理器预留了专用的访问接口,如图4-3所示。因此NICE 协处理器可以访问主...
-
NICE协处理器在蜂鸟E203处理器中的位置如图4-2所示。图4-2 NICE协处理器在蜂鸟E203处理器中的位置NICE指令的完整执行过程如下。(1)主处理器的译码单元在EXU级对指令的操作码进行译...
-
队伍编号:CICC3136队伍名称:叫啥来着对对队文章编号:1在蜂鸟E203处理器核中,使用NICE(Nuclei Instruction Co-unit Extension,核指令协同单元扩展)机制...
-
大家好,我是队伍CCIC1604。前段时间给大家分享了一个算法方面的一些知识,今天给大家介绍一下蜂鸟E203软核使用NICE接口实现硬件加速。首先让我们来了解一下什么是NICE接口。 NICE指令格...
-
asm ( assembler template: output operands / optional /: input operands / optional /: list of clobber...
-
团队名称:三合一队报名编号:CICC3967文章编号:5一、上电配置时序分析 OV5640的上电时序在其 datasheet 中明确给出了,如下所示:注意 DOVDD 和 AVDD 是 O...
-
大家好,我们是cicc1518队
-
团队名称:三合一队报名编号:CICC3967文章编号:4OV5640在上电之后要做的首先是通过 SCCB 协议对摄像头的寄存器进行配置。SCCB协议的 SCL 要求不高于400Khz,我们设置为 25...
-
大家好,我们是seu120队,编号是CICC1518,此次分享Nuclei Studio ide的一点心得。
-
在对图片实现目标检测时,需要将原始图片信息和权重信息传如协处理器,并在计算完成后输出。首先 我们通过自定义指令lbuf将数据传入协处理器的buffer中,此时数据是8位宽,由于我们的卷积核加速器的输入...
-
我们的队伍编号是CICC2985,队名JLA。e203的操作单元包括逻辑运算、加法、减法、移位等指令。将分支和跳转指令发送到分支预测分析单元,以执行分支预测分析。对于无法预测的指令,需要管道刷新和指令...
-
团队编号:CICC2554 团队名称:Target Detected本次全国大学生集成电路创新创业大赛,我们的作品是基于蜂鸟E203 RISC-V内核来进行目标检测。YOLO全称叫You Only...
-
团队编号:CICC2554 团队名称:Target Detected本次全国大学生集成电路创新创业大赛,我们的作品是基于蜂鸟E203 RISC-V内核来进行目标检测。【数据集制作】(1) 下...
-
大家好,我们是seu120队,队伍编号是CICC1518,此次分享芯来hello world例程,并维护芯来的文档,有少些内容需要修改。生成bit和mcs文件并没有遇到问题,参考:https://do...
-
团队名称:三合一队报名编号:CICC3967文章编号:3 SCCB(Serial Camera Control Bus,串行摄像头控制总线)是由OV(OmniVision的简称)公司定义和...
-
【队伍编号:CICC3184 Balance】更新一下,之前内容有错误参考链接 FPGA上外挂DDR2DDR3MIG IP的使用记录 https://www.cnblogs.com/kingstack...
-
【队伍编号:CICC3184 Balance】参考链接 https://www.rvmcu.com/community-topic-id-353.html https://lgyserver.top/...
-
关于将OV5640摄像头挂载到蜂鸟e203外设模块上,建议直接采用用C程序模拟SCCB协议的方法。我尝试过在硬件程序端进行配置,如果不挂核,配置是完全没有问题,加上核配置就会出错,摄像头无法工作,至今...
-
【队伍编号:CICC3184 Balance】图书的百度网盘链接,需要自取: https://blog.csdn.net/qq_43858116/article/details/123193844?s...
-
在利用FPGA进行目标检测的过程中,需要将图片信息传入FPGA内进行计算。起初,我们想在nuclei studio中利用fopen函数得到图片的信息,再将图片信息直接通过自定义指令传入协处理器进行运算...
-
编写verilog驱动3.2寸tft显示屏,首先按照数据手册模拟spi协议,需要配置的寄存器有90个,其中重要的寄存器是8’h36,其值为A8表示横屏,68也是横屏(倒过来)。08或者c8是竖屏。正常...
-
一、SDRAM缓存处理 OV5640 生成像素和 VGA 请求像素的时间不一致,导致VGA总是要不到一帧图像正确的数据,也要不全一帧图像正确的数据。因此,OV5640 和 VGA 之间...
-
Valid-Ready握手协议 为了保持数据的传输,通常使用握手信号。握手协议的原则是: 当Valid和Ready信号同时高有效时,数据在时钟上升沿传输。 作为一种双向流控机制,VALID/READ...
-
本队伍编号CICC2985,团队名称JLA。因为数据提取之后是十进制小数,为了方便计算和存储避免错误,因此将十进制小数转为32为ieee单精度浮点数。 IEEE754 32位floatIEEE754是...
-
我们是cicc1518队,本次分享虚拟机环境用于后续开发为了把时间更多的用于作品设计,我把师兄的虚拟机分享出来。链接:链接:https://pan.baidu.com/s/1QfTOkXKtzF8Kp...
-
芯来公司的MCU200T开发板上的存储资源非常有限,较大的存储有psram,这里放上该开发板上的psram芯片数据手册,https://download.csdn.net/download/Xchao...
-
我们是cicc1518队伍,本次分析nice demo仿真在前面,我们已经介绍了如何创建工程,把那么如何生成.verilog呢?command的内容如下:2、虚拟机准备在vsim目录下make ins...
-
本次我们将分享在DDR200T实现肤色检测算法的相关知识。水平有限,如果有错误希望大家多多批评指正。一、YCbCr颜色空间 在YCbCr的颜色空间是一种常用的肤色检测的色彩模型,其中Y代表亮度,Cr代...
-
大家好,我们是参加2022集创赛的电子空穴队,队伍编号CICC1821。 由于在Linux系统调试的过程中,gdb是一个十分重要的工具,在这里跟大家分享gdb部分恢复执行的命令解析。 continue...
-
在蜂鸟E203软核上部署神经网络的过程中,由于通常只能部署小型网络,这意味着网络的输入会很小(比如2828或者是3232)。但是,通过系统的摄像头拍摄的照片,却往往会比这个大小大很多(比如OV5640...
-
1、团队介绍团队名称:随变队,报名编号:CICC2761 2、图像压缩卷积神经网络所需要的图像是28x28像素,而摄像的像素通常为800x480像素。当然摄像的数据是可以调节的,不过通常还需要加上一个...
-
一.团队介绍我们是随变队,报名编号是CICC2761。二.分享内容由于我们使用的板子并不是官方板,所以板子上很并没有足够的空余管脚用来分配软核E203的GPIO管脚等。 如果直接拉空某些管脚,会导致无...
-
大家好,本队伍编号CICC3521,团队名称彼泊舟队,本次文章我来分享一下我的流片的dc综合脚本说明。除了仿真与FPGA验证,我们还将基于N205的可配置CNN加速SoC在180nm下进行了流片验证,...
-
本队伍编号CICC2985,团队名称JLA,这里简要分析一下NICE接口。协处理器的存储访问通道为ICB总线,当需要访问存储器时需要通过ICB总线请求通道向主处理器发送请求,然后通过ICB总线的反馈通...